Thank you for sharing this webinar! It was, once again, very informative and inspiring! - I am literally incapable of learning word lists. I was useless in learning Latin like that - and it was (or still is?) the way "dead" languages are taught. I only built a considerable vocabulary by reading texts - preferably those I liked most (which were not the ones about endless battles...). The same for Old French and Old Provencal: both languages I learned by reading only and reading texts I enjoyed - or I found compelling. Like I mentioned in an interview with Stephen Krashen, I acquired two of my languages, both when I was adult.
